Picking the Right Windows and Doors
When selecting new doors and windows, there are a number of elements that homeowners must consider:
1. Product Options:
- Vinyl: Affordable and low-maintenance, with great insulation residential or commercial properties.
- Wood: Offers a traditional appearance however requires regular upkeep to avoid decay.
- Aluminum: Durable and strong; however, it can transfer cold and heat more than other products.
- Fiberglass: Highly durable and energy-efficient, imitating the appearance of wood without the maintenance.
2. Energy Efficiency Ratings:
- Look for the Energy Star label, which suggests the item satisfies energy effectiveness standards.
- Comprehend the R-value (insulation ability) and U-factor (rate of heat transfer) to select a choice that fits your climate.
3. Style and Style:
- Choose designs that complement the architecture of your home; options consist of double-hung, casement, sliding, and bay windows.
- For doors, consider sliding glass doors, French doors, or bi-fold doors depending on your style preferences.
4. Installation:
- Proper installation is important for making the most of the advantages of new doors and windows. Hiring professional specialists with experience makes sure that the installation process is executed correctly.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How frequently should I change my windows and doors?
- A1: The life-span of windows and doors varies by product. Normally, you should think about replacement every 15-20 years, while wooden models might need replacement earlier due to use and tear.
Q2: Can I change simply a few windows or doors, or is it essential to do them all at once?
- A2: While changing all doors and windows simultaneously can offer an uniform appearance and increased energy effectiveness, it's not strictly essential. Property owners can replace them gradually according to budget and requirements.
Q3: Will new windows and doors increase my home's worth?
- A3: Yes, installing new doors and windows is among the most reliable upgrades a house owner can make to improve home value and appeal to prospective purchasers.
Q4: What is the typical cost of new windows and doors?
- A4: Costs can vary widely based on products and style however normally variety from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window and 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 4,000 per door.
